#4d5bdc basic color information

#4d5bdc

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4d5bdc has decimal index of: 5069788, is composed of 30.2% red, 35.7% green and 86.3% blue. #4d5bdc in CMYK color model, is composed of 65%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black.
#6666cc is the closest web-safe color to #4d5bdc.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
